Output 81f60305da6cc980c3ccb672832eda2f2ed9b9b45350778037d84465101449e5:0

value
26118866339
script pubkey
OP_0 OP_PUSHBYTES_20 107f7efff21a5a0cd2911a910b9d5aa0893e9b3a
address
ltc1qzplhalljrfdqe553r2gsh8265zynaxe6q97q7x
transaction
81f60305da6cc980c3ccb672832eda2f2ed9b9b45350778037d84465101449e5
spent
true